Output 44b153149d6ec373367d00a2779c696ec2ccd66303b07c7dc039a64fb0276f83:3

value
15171417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202dc30ebcb3be7bd77fba33a3113df28cc16797 OP_EQUAL
address
34dANH59dhHqGgNp78ZxULD1WmiprihtzM
transaction
44b153149d6ec373367d00a2779c696ec2ccd66303b07c7dc039a64fb0276f83
spent
true